The latest officially reported population of Algeria was 47,435,312 in 2025 vs 392,404 people in Iceland in 2025. In 2026, based on the adjusted UN estimation, the current Algeria's population is 48,345,858 people compared to 398,674 in Iceland.

Population statistics:

  • Algeria's population is 121.3 times bigger than Iceland's.
  • Algeria is ranked the 34th most populous country in the world, while Iceland is the 173rd.
  • The countries together account for 0.59% of the world: 0.58% for Algeria vs 0.005% for Iceland.
  • For the last 10 years, Algeria has had an average growth rate of +1.75% per year vs +1.66% in Iceland.
  • Since 2006, the population of Algeria has increased from 33.6M people to 48.3M (43.8% growth), while Iceland has grown from 304K to 399K (31.2% growth).

From 2006 to 2016, the population of Algeria increased by 7,227,215 people (a 21.5% growth), while Iceland gained 31,657 people (a 10.4% growth).

For the next 10 years, from 2016 to 2026, Algeria gained 7,495,137 people (a 18.3% growth), while Iceland's population increased by 63,235 people (a 18.9% growth).

Algeria was ranked 34th most populous country in 2006 and is still 34th in 2026. Iceland was ranked 172nd in 2006 and ranked 173rd now.

The UN's World Population Prospects forecasts that in 24 years (in 2050) Algeria's population will grow by 23.6% to 59,737,427 people with a rank change from 34th to 33rd. The population of Iceland will increase by 7.61% to 429,028 people and will still be ranked 173rd.

Algeria is projected to reach its peak in 2091 at 65.5M people compared to the peak of 429K people in 2050 for Iceland.

Over the last 10 years, 97.5% of the population change in Algeria is from natural causes (a gain of 7,718,579 people) and 2.49% is from migration (a loss of 196,899 people). In Iceland 29% is from natural causes (a gain of 19,543 people) and 71% is from migration (a gain of 47,760 people).

As of 2024, 259,458 residents or 0.6% of the population were not native-born in Algeria, compared to 98,818 people or 25.1% in Iceland.
